Elon Musk's 'Department of Government Efficiency': A Shift Toward A.I.-Driven Governance

Recent developments have shifted the public perception of Elon Musk's Department of Government Efficiency (DOGE) from a typical Republican initiative focused on slashing government spending to something much broader. Initially viewed as a potential tool for curtailing bureaucracy—mirroring Musk's drastic staff cuts at Twitter (now X)—it's becoming evident that Musk aims to embed his ambitious technological vision within the federal government itself. To lead DOGE, Musk has assembled a team of tech managers and young interns, primarily from SpaceX, who have begun questioning federal employees, interfering with Treasury Department payment processes, and scrutinizing government budgets, all while Musk targets specific agencies on X. This initiative is heavily supported by artificial intelligence tools. A senior official recently indicated that the government will adopt an “A. I. -first strategy, ” exploring plans like a chatbot to review contracts and using A. I. software to seek budget cuts, particularly in the Department of Education. Reports suggest intrusive A. I. filters are blocking proposals at the Department of Treasury based on keywords like “climate change. ” In essence, the federal government is being operated like a tech startup, with Musk—an unelected billionaire—testing unproven technologies on a national scale. He is not alone in promoting A. I. as a societal panacea; notable tech figures, like Marc Andreessen, have suggested catastrophic wage reductions will occur alongside an almost miraculous drop in the cost of goods and services due to A. I.
Musk’s connections, particularly his close role with the Trump administration and a significant investment bid targeting OpenAI, position him uniquely to blend governmental and Silicon Valley interests. Traditionally, government processes are deliberate and measured, whereas Musk’s A. I. -driven approach prioritizes speed and efficiency, often at the cost of human involvement. His initiatives have already led to the complete shutdown of several agencies, like USAID and the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au, which had previously challenged tech companies. As Musk sidelines traditional oversight and risks constitutional confrontation, he is reshaping the government into a more authoritarian structure driven by machine feedback, fostering what some are calling “techno-fascism by chatbot. ” Currently, some low-level decision-making in government utilizes A. I. , but Musk’s vision seeks wider adoption that could confront democratic processes. Decisions that typically require nuanced human judgment are increasingly reliant on A. I. outputs, which are not yet reliable enough to replace human reasoning. For example, during a recent Super Bowl commercial, Google’s new A. I. incorrectly claimed that Gouda accounted for over half of global cheese consumption. Nevertheless, Musk seems undeterred, recently using A. I. data to make legal accusations against Treasury officials, despite swift legal counterclaims from experts.
